Why AI matters at this scale

The Joint IED Defeat Organization (JIEDDO) is a U.S. Department of Defense organization established in 2006 to lead the national effort to defeat improvised explosive devices. With a workforce of 1,001-5,000, it focuses on rapidly developing and fielding solutions, integrating intelligence, and coordinating counter-IED efforts across military services and agencies. At this scale and mission-critical mandate, JIEDDO operates at the intersection of massive data flows and urgent operational needs. AI is not a luxury but a force multiplier, essential for parsing the volume, velocity, and variety of threat data that outpaces human analytical capacity. For an organization of this size, AI enables scalable analysis, turning data overload into actionable, predictive insights that can save lives and resources.

Concrete AI Opportunities with ROI

1. Predictive Intelligence for Proactive Defense: By applying machine learning to historical attack data, signals intelligence, and open-source information, JIEDDO can move from reactive to predictive operations. Models could identify patterns signaling IED cell formation or supply chain movements, allowing for preemptive disruption. The ROI is direct: fewer attacks, reduced casualties, and more efficient allocation of investigative and defensive resources.

2. Automated Sensor and Forensic Analysis: Computer vision AI can process thousands of hours of drone footage or images from ground sensors to detect anomalies indicative of IEDs. Natural language processing can rapidly analyze thousands of forensic reports and captured documents to link incidents and actors. Automating these labor-intensive tasks accelerates the investigative cycle, leading to faster network disruption and freeing expert personnel for higher-level analysis. The ROI includes accelerated mission tempo and better utilization of skilled personnel.

3. Simulation and Training via Digital Twins: Creating AI-driven digital twins of operational environments allows JIEDDO to simulate countless IED emplacement scenarios and test countermeasure tactics virtually. This reduces the cost and risk of physical testing, accelerates technology development cycles, and provides superior training for personnel. The ROI manifests in lower R&D costs, faster fielding of effective solutions, and better-prepared forces.

Deployment Risks for a 1,001-5,000 Person Organization

Deploying AI in an organization of JIEDDO's size and complexity presents specific risks. Integration Challenges: Legacy military IT systems and strict data classification (e.g., JWICS, SIPRNet) can create silos, making it difficult to build unified data pipelines for AI training. Talent and Culture: While large enough to have IT staff, attracting and retaining specialized AI/ML talent in competition with the private sector is difficult. There may also be cultural resistance from analysts wary of opaque "black box" models making life-or-death recommendations. Procurement and Pace: The defense acquisition process is often slow and rigid, ill-suited for the iterative, fail-fast nature of AI development. This can lead to outdated solutions by the time they are fielded. Ethical and Explainability Scrutiny: Any AI system recommending actions that could lead to lethal outcomes will face intense scrutiny. Ensuring models are robust, unbiased, and explainable is paramount but technically and procedurally challenging. Mitigating these risks requires strong leadership to champion agile procurement pilots, investment in data infrastructure, and a focus on human-AI teaming frameworks that build trust.

How can AI improve IED defeat efforts?
AI excels at finding subtle patterns in massive, disparate datasets—like signals intelligence, social media, and sensor feeds—to predict attacks, identify bomb-making networks, and optimize counter-strategies faster than human analysts alone.
What are the main barriers to AI adoption in defense organizations?
Key challenges include stringent data security/classification, integration with legacy military IT systems, ensuring AI model robustness and explainability for high-stakes decisions, and navigating lengthy procurement cycles.
